Stampede meaning
Stampede is a versatile word that can be used in various contexts to describe a sudden and uncontrollable rush or movement of a large group of people or animals. Whether you are writing an essay, a story, or simply trying to expand your vocabulary, incorporating the word "stampede" into your sentences can add depth and vividness to your writing.
